Abstract

We have constructed cDNA library from the larvae whole body of the firefly, Pyrocoelia rufa. Single direct partial sequencing of anonymous cDNA clones was performed to obtain genetic information on the firefly, P. rufa, of which genetic information is currently not available. This expressed sequence tags (EST) analysis of the 54 clones (54%) showed significant homology to the known genes registered in GenBank. Of these clones, twenty-four were related to the known insect genes, but these clones were not matched to previously identified firefly genes. Putative functional categories of these clones showed that the next abundant genes were associated with energy metabolism.
